Pits Atlas: Crookes 10
| Impact Melt pit: Crookes | |
|---|---|
| Name | Crookes 10 |
| Lat. | -10.1717 |
| Long. | 194.8302 |
| Desc. | Elliptical pit with the long axis running NNE-SSW. N and S ends appear to have ramps running from rim to floor (S ramp is much wider). There is a chain of collapses running roughly E-W, with the E end ~140m NW of this point. There are a few minor collapses running ~100m W from this pit. Crookes 9 is ~180m E. |
